T. Kathirvalavakumar is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and Information Systems. According to data from OpenAlex, T. Kathirvalavakumar has authored 27 papers receiving a total of 397 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 14 papers in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and 8 papers in Information Systems. Recurrent topics in T. Kathirvalavakumar's work include Neural Networks and Applications (13 papers), Face and Expression Recognition (6 papers) and Data Mining Algorithms and Applications (5 papers). T. Kathirvalavakumar is often cited by papers focused on Neural Networks and Applications (13 papers), Face and Expression Recognition (6 papers) and Data Mining Algorithms and Applications (5 papers). T. Kathirvalavakumar collaborates with scholars based in India, Norway and Ireland. T. Kathirvalavakumar's co-authors include M. Gethsiyal Augasta, Rajendra Prasath, Anil Kumar Vuppala and Philip O’Reilly and has published in prestigious journals such as Neurocomputing, Applied Soft Computing and Lecture notes in computer science.
